【Yangpingguan】
The prestige of this pass is due to the tug of war between Shu Han and Cao Wei during the Three Kingdoms period. In fact, it is not weaker than Tongguan and other world-famous passes.
Yangping Pass is bordered by the Qinling Mountains to the north and the Han River and Bashan Mountain to the south. It is daunting due to the dangers of the mountains and rivers.
It is almost an impossible task to break through Yangping Pass head-on.
From the end of the Eastern Han Dynasty to the Three Kingdoms period, Yangping Pass was only attacked from the side three times.
The first time was when Liu Yan, the current Yizhou shepherd, sent Zhang Lu northward from the Jinniu Ancient Road to attack Yangping Pass. Zhang Luna crossed the Han River to the south and took a small road to occupy Dingjun Mountain, and then went north to occupy Tiandang Mountain and killed Su Gu, the governor of Hanzhong at the time.
He began his more than 20-year rule of the "Five Pecks of Rice Sect".
The second time was when Cao Cao led an army of 100,000 men to attack Yangping Pass, but was turned away. Then he used the strategy of pretending to surrender to lure the Yangping Pass defenders out of the pass to pursue them, and captured Yangping Pass in one fell swoop.
The third time was the most familiar Battle of Hanzhong between Liu Bei and Cao Cao.
Like Zhang Lu's attack on Yangping Pass, Liu Bei also secretly sent Huang Zhong south to cross the Han River, and defeated and killed Xiahou Yuan at Dingjun Mountain, causing Cao Wei's army to become distraught. In addition, Cao Wei had insufficient food and grass, so he had no choice but to retreat.
Let Liu Bei achieve the achievement of "defeating Cao Cao head-on for the first time in his career".
